Leaded axial inductor for high voltages

31 January 2017 Passive Components

Fastron has added a new high-voltage leaded axial inductor to its product portfolio. Utilising a special winding wire and a new coating, the choke can operate at voltage levels up to 400 V and can withstand higher peak voltage. Using a ferrite core, the XHBHV offers inductance values from 100 μH to 6800 μH, ±5% tolerance, maximum DCR from 0,22 Ω to 14,16 Ω, and current ratings from 0,22 A to 1,76 A.

The inductors are a supplement to the standard leaded axial inductors for designs which are directly connected to the power line. Major applications for the XHBHV series are suppression of transients as well as EMC filtering in electrical motors and in switching power supplies used in home appliances, industrial, lighting and automotive applications.

The operating temperature range, including self-heating, is from -55°C to +125°C. With a body length of 16 mm and a diameter of 7,5 mm, the XHBHV is offered in tape-and-reel and taped ammo pack. It is suitable for lead-free soldering and is RoHS compliant.
